How they compare

Hungary currently reports 3,131 constant 2015 US$ per person against 2,458 constant 2015 US$ per person in Chile, a difference of 673 constant 2015 US$ per person.

That makes Hungary's figure about 1.3 times Chile's.

Across all 35 years both countries report, Hungary has been ahead every year.

Chile ranks 57th and Hungary ranks 54th of 168 countries.

Hungary has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Chile Hungary Difference Ahead
1990s 1,134 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,861 constant 2015 US$ per person 727.41 constant 2015 US$ per person Hungary
2000s 1,332 constant 2015 US$ per person 2,122 constant 2015 US$ per person 790.06 constant 2015 US$ per person Hungary
2010s 1,817 constant 2015 US$ per person 2,477 constant 2015 US$ per person 659.95 constant 2015 US$ per person Hungary
2020s 2,266 constant 2015 US$ per person 3,008 constant 2015 US$ per person 742.2 constant 2015 US$ per person Hungary

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
